Beware of Relay Theft

two black and brass colored vehicle keys with fob

Keyless entry is one of the most convenient features of newer cars. Unfortunately, though, this user-friendly feature is also a favorite for car thieves. Security experts are warning of a relatively new scam centered on key fobs. In this scam, thieves use a simple device to pick up the signal from a vehicle’s key fob and use it to steal the car.
